2013-02-01Makefile: explicitly set target name for autogenerated dependenciesJonathan Nieder
"gcc -MF depfile -MMD -MP -c -o path/to/file.o" produces a makefile snippet named "depfile" describing what files are needed to build the target given by "-o". When ccache versions before v3.0pre0~187 (Fix handling of the -MD and -MDD options, 2009-11-01) run, they execute gcc -MF depfile -MMD -MP -E instead to get the final content for hashing. Notice that the "-c -o" combination is replaced by "-E". The result is a target name without a leading path. Thus when building git with such versions of ccache with COMPUTE_HEADER_DEPENDENCIES enabled, the generated makefile snippets define dependencies for the wrong target: $ make builtin/add.o GIT_VERSION = 1.7.8.rc3 * new build flags or prefix CC builtin/add.o $ head -1 builtin/.depend/add.o.d add.o: builtin/add.c cache.h git-compat-util.h compat/bswap.h strbuf.h \ After a change in a header file, object files in a subdirectory are not automatically rebuilt by "make": $ touch cache.h $ make builtin/add.o $ Luckily we can prevent trouble by explicitly supplying the name of the target to ccache and gcc, using the -MQ option. Do so. 2013-01-31apply: diagnose incomplete submodule object name betterJunio C Hamano
"git am -3" uses this function to build a tree that records how the preimage the patch was created from would have looked like. An abbreviated object name on the index line is ordinarily sufficient for us to figure out the object name the preimage tree would have contained, but a change to a submodule by definition shows an object name of a submodule commit which our repository should not have, and get_sha1_blob() is not an appropriate way to read it (or get_sha1() for that matter). Use get_sha1_hex() and complain if we do not find a full object name there. We could read from the payload part of the patch to learn the full object name of the commit, but the primary user "git rebase" has been fixed to give us a full object name, so this should suffice for now. 2013-01-31git-am: record full index line in the patch used while rebasingJunio C Hamano
Earlier, a230949 (am --rebasing: get patch body from commit, not from mailbox, 2012-06-26) learned to regenerate patch body from the commit object while rebasing, instead of reading from the rebase-am front-end. While doing so, it used "git diff-tree" but without giving it the "--full-index" option. This does not matter for in-repository objects; during rebasing, any abbreviated object name should uniquely identify them. But we may be rebasing a commit that contains a change to a gitlink, in which case we usually should not have the object (it names a commit in the submodule). A full object name is necessary to later reconstruct a fake ancestor index for them. Signed-off-by: Junio C Hamano <gitster@pobox.com>
2013-01-31gpg: close stderr once finished with it in verify_signed_buffer()Stephen Boyd
Failing to close the stderr pipe in verify_signed_buffer() causes git to run out of file descriptors if there are many calls to verify_signed_buffer(). An easy way to trigger this is to run git log --show-signature --merges | grep "key" on the linux kernel git repo. Eventually it will fail with error: cannot create pipe for gpg: Too many open files error: could not run gpg. Close the stderr pipe so that this can't happen. 2013-01-26git-p4.py: support Python 2.4Brandon Casey
Python 2.4 lacks the following features: subprocess.check_call struct.pack_into Take a cue from 460d1026 and provide an implementation of the CalledProcessError exception. Then replace the calls to subproccess.check_call with calls to subprocess.call that check the return status and raise a CalledProcessError exception if necessary. The struct.pack_into in t/9802 can be converted into a single struct.pack call which is available in Python 2.4. 2013-01-25ident: do not drop username when reading from /etc/mailnameJonathan Nieder
An earlier conversion from fgets() to strbuf_getline() in the codepath to read from /etc/mailname to learn the default host-part of the ident e-mail address forgot that strbuf_getline() stores the line at the beginning of the buffer just like fgets(). The "username@" the caller has prepared in the strbuf, expecting the function to append the host-part to it, was lost because of this. 2013-01-24git-cvsimport.txt: cvsps-2 is deprecatedJohn Keeping
git-cvsimport relies on version 2 of cvsps and does not work with the new version 3. Since cvsps 3.x does not currently work as well as version 2 for incremental import, document this fact. Specifically, there is no way to make new git-cvsimport that supports cvsps 3.x and have a seamless transition for existing users since cvsps 3.x needs a time from which to continue importing and git-cvsimport does not save the time of the last import or import into a specific namespace so there is no safe way to calculate the time of the last import.
